<html> <head> <title>Profiler: test console controlling of CPU profiling</title> <script type="text/javascript" src="resources/fib.js"></script> <script type="text/javascript"> function profile_fib() { console.profile(); run_fib(); window.setTimeout('console.profileEnd();', 5000); } </script> </head> <body onload="profile_fib()"> This test runs and profiles a simple looped computation. <br> <br> TEST <ul> <li>load file in the browser; <li>open DevTools with console (Ctrl+Shift+I on Win/Linux, Command+Option+I on Mac); <li>go to 'Profiles' page; <li>observe that 'Profile 1' item has appeared under 'CPU profiles' section; <li>check for presence of 'eternal_fib' entry in the profile view. </ul> <br> </body> </html>